In the early hours of last Saturday morning, Alexandria Governorate was exposed to a wave of unstable weather, interspersed with thunderstorms and snow accompanied by severe winds of 83 km/h, which resulted in a number of losses and damage to public facilities and some real estate and cars.
According to the main operations room and the control center in the governorate, 48 rainwater gatherings were monitored in several areas that were dealt with immediately, in addition to 10 parties partially damaged in several neighborhoods, and the fall of 7 lighting poles in different neighborhoods.
The provincial operations room also received reports of the fall of 8 advertisements in the neighborhoods that were removed immediately, in addition to receiving 6 various reports that included a tree fall, a car fire, a lighting cable, an air conditioning unit, and iron pipes for restoration work.
